Appendix K.    AS2 Routing IDs

NOTE: The Pre-production System (v5.5.2) now supports the use of AS2 Routing IDs for all gateway systems. The ESG production system currently does not support the use of AS2 Routing IDs for non-Axway gateway software. No production implementation date for v5.5.2 has been set.

As an alternative to using the AS2 Header Attributes (Appendix G) process for sending submissions to the FDA ESG, you can use unique routing IDs for your submissions to indicate the type of submission and the intended Center.  This Appendix describes how to automate the selection of the routing ID in Cyclone/Axway products through the incoming back-end integration pickup.  If you are not using a Cyclone/Axway product, refer to your gateway software's documentation for help configuring routing IDs.

The routing IDs for each submission type are listed at the end of the appendix. 

Before routing IDs can be selected, they must be added to your partner profile.

  1. In your FDA partner profile, click on the "Routing IDs" link.

  2. Use the "Add" button at the bottom of the page to add extra routing IDs to the FDA partner.

    Note: "ZZFDA" (production) or "ZZFDATST" (test) must be the first routing ID listed. Otherwise, the submission will not be processed correctly by the FDA.

    Only file system integration pickups have the ability to automatically select a routing ID. If you are not currently using file system integration pickups to interface with the back-end server, you must create a file system integration pickup must be created.  Refer to your gateway software's documentation for more information on this procedure.

  3. After you create a file system integration pickup, create a directory structure on the disk that matches the routing ID's path and configure the integration pickup to automatically select a routing ID based on directory names.
  4. In this example, the path to the integration pickup is C:\bin\cyclone\common\data\out, as shown in Figure 3: File System Settings, Directory Name.  This path should match the directory structure you created in step 3.

    Click on the Message attributes tab. This will access the following screen:

    Your list of Available attributes may differ from those shown. The only attribute here that must be on your list is To routing ID which is highlighted here.

  5. Click on To routing ID in the list of attributes. Then click on the Add button. After the screen refreshes, To routing ID should be listed under Selected attributes:

  6. Click on the Save changes button to commit the changes to the integration pickup.
  7. Next, create the appropriate directories in the file system to match the FDA Routing IDs to which submissions are to be sent.

    Figure 6: Available Routing shows a sample directory and subdirectories that correspond to some of the available routing IDs.  A complete list of routing IDs for the FDA ESG are in Figure 7: Submission Types Supported by the FDA ESG.

  8. Create subdirectories beneath the base integration pickup directory as shown, then drop the documents that you wish to submit into the appropriate directory.  For example, to send an AERS report, place the document in the "FDA_AERS" directory.

For multi-document submissions, the original directory structure must be converted to a single file by using "tar" and then "gzip", and the resulting file must have an extension of .tar.gz for the FDA ESG to correctly recognize it as a multi-document submission.  You must  perform the tar and gzip procedure before dropping the file into the appropriate directory, since the Cyclone/Axway software does not know how to tar and gzip on its own.

    Note: FDA_AERS and FDA_AERS_ATTACHMENTS submissions cannot be sent as multi-document submissions under any circumstances.
